I'm trying to do a clean reinstall of ManaLink because of some corrupted files, but I'd rather not play thorough all of the challenges I've beaten. Are the challenge mode accomplishments stored on a single file that I can back up before uninstalling?

Copy your "Faces" folder. This is where the Challenge progress is getting stored at.Each unlocked card should have its own file in there.
